Nucleotide-binding protein 2 (NBP 2) also known as cytosolic Fe-S cluster assembly factor NUBP2 is a protein that in humans is encoded by the NUBP2 gene.

NUBP2 is a member of the NUBP/MRP gene subfamily of ATP-binding proteins. Interactions

NUBP2 has been shown to interact with...

  • ACO1 Iron-responsive element-binding protein 1 (IRE-BP 1) (Iron regulatory protein 1) (IRP1)
  • MAPK8IP3 C-jun-amino-terminal kinase-interacting protein 3 (JNK-interacting protein 3) (JIP-3)
  • IGFALS Insulin-like growth factor-binding protein complex acid labile chain precursor (ALS)
  • KIF11 Kinesin-like protein KIF11 (Kinesin-related motor protein Eg5)
  • SEPP1 Selenoprotein P precursor (SeP)
  • CA1 Carbonic anhydrase 1 (EC 4.2.1.1) (Carbonic anhydrase I) (Carbonate dehydratase I) (CA-I)
